  1. Yes, the rent crisis in Australia is still a significant issue, and it varies from city to city. While some areas may have seen a slight stabilization in rental prices, many places, including Perth, are still facing high demand and limited supply. Factors like population growth, low vacancy rates, and rising interest rates contribute to the ongoing challenges in the rental market.

    It’s not just Perth; other major cities like Sydney and Melbourne are also experiencing high rental prices. Regional areas might offer more affordable options, but they often come with their own set of challenges. If you’re struggling to find affordable rental options, it might be worth exploring different suburbs or considering shared living arrangements to ease the financial burden.
